# Break-Glass: Catalog Cache Invalidation

Scope: the Pinrow product catalog at Veldstone Retail. If stale prices persist after a purge and the Hollowmere invalidation queue is wedged, use break-glass to flush the edge tier directly. Contractors: get verbal sign-off from the catalog lead first. Steps: open the Hollowmere admin shell, select emergency-flush, confirm the tenant, and run it once — repeated flushes thrash the origin. Access is logged and expires after 20 minutes. Unseal the admin shell with the passphrase below.

recovery phrase for kahop-tajog: istix-casvan

### Step 4: Enable the formula sandbox

All user-supplied formulas in Calcroft now execute inside the hollowcell sandbox. Do not call the legacy evaluator; it's removed in this release. Wire your worker to the sandbox socket, set resource caps, and run the conformance suite before merging. The sandbox reads its limits at startup, and the required values are listed below.

settings of yahof-tageg:
[praath]
port = 5672
region = north-1
host = praath.norvacorp.internal
timeout_ms = 500
retries = 2

RETURN FLOW — DEMO UNITS (VELTRIX KIOSKS)

All returned Veltrix demo kiosks from the Harlowe Fair route arrive via Kestrel Freight, Tuesdays only. Check seals against the return manifest. Units with broken seals go straight to quarantine shelf B; do not power on. Log condition photos before unboxing. Batteries ship separately — refuse any unit with a battery still installed. Escalate discrepancies to the returns coordinator before noon.

The courier will not release the pallet without the confirmation phrase below.

handover note for yagef-bagep: the drudor pelius courier leaves the kasdor zorvan norir ledger at gate 8016 under passcode 755406

## Night-Shift Access — Support Team

Heads up, reception: the Pallindrome support crew works overnight shifts at Wrenfield Tower, usually 22:00 to 06:00. Their regular badges stop working on the main doors after 21:30 (yes, it's annoying, and yes, facilities knows). Until the badge system gets its long-promised update, night-shift folks come in through the riverside entrance next to the café. Don't buzz them in through the lobby — security gets grumpy about it. Instead, point them to the riverside keypad and give them the code below.

turnstile pass: bdg-MGQAU-99984